A bit of amplification is in order.
1. The program may be coded to forget the folder assignment that you made.
Many do that, unfortunately.
2. The program may try to store its info in its own folder in the Programs
or Programs (x86) folder tree. This doesn't do well in Vista - it wants
them to use a folder under Documents or somewhere.
Either of those problems ultimately is a result of how the program was
made. I have the second problem in MesNews, for instance. I think in some
cases you can work around it by installing a program in the wrong place,
i.e., not in one of the Programs folders.
